Abstract(in English) | The spread of social networking services (SNS) has dramatically activated communication between users, but it has also become a factor in accelerating the division of the real world. In online social networks, even if users are directly connected to each other, a community structure that seems to be divided in effect appears. In this paper. The mechanism of occurrence of such a phenomenon will be examined. |
